Output 635b3afcaa36d5f0aef87d0fafe43dd0d1cb8caec22c1f76283833453cfeb8b5:33

value
1679032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4fb1af4503170f6718e5fc25364972b3e1504f OP_EQUAL
address
3Ekn2DZFrfZLMxGQX37CkWSu2gydxeLjZb
transaction
635b3afcaa36d5f0aef87d0fafe43dd0d1cb8caec22c1f76283833453cfeb8b5
confirmations
272880
spent
true